Alert: Intermittent websocket reconnect loop affecting Lumabridge Chat sessions. When a client's connection drops mid-handshake, the reconnect logic retries with a stale session token, causing repeated 401 responses and visible "reconnecting" banners for users. Impact is limited to sessions idle longer than 10 minutes. Workaround: advise users to fully refresh the page, which forces a new token. Engineering is tracking a fix in the Quillgate client library. Full triage steps for support are documented on the internal page below.

runbook for kawef-hahif: https://jira.lumicsys.internal/projects/browse/display/c08d703c

## Support

Quillhook delivers webhooks with at-least-once semantics: failed deliveries retry on an exponential backoff schedule (1m, 5m, 30m, 2h, 12h) before landing in the dead-letter view. Consumers must deduplicate using the delivery ID header, since retries can overlap with slow acknowledgements. If you observe duplicate suppression failing or retries exceeding the documented schedule, open an issue with delivery IDs attached, or write to the maintainers.

alerts address for kajog-tadup: druox@plorvanet.internal

## Fan-out recovery — Stormrelay

If weather-alert fan-out stalls, first confirm the Gustline queue depth, then restart the dispatcher pods in order (north region first). Plugin authors testing against the sandbox must authenticate every fan-out call; unauthenticated requests are dropped silently. Use the sandbox credential provided below when configuring your plugin.

app token of tagef-tafog = qvz3-7n0

Subject: Password reset cut-over complete

Hi — welcome aboard. Last night we finished moving the Verdella password reset flow to the new Keyline service. Token issuance, rate limiting, and email dispatch all now run through Keyline; the legacy path is disabled but not yet removed. Please read this carefully before touching reset code. The production configuration now in effect is shown below.

config for kafof-bawef:
holath:
  log_level: debug
  metrics_host: metrics.holath.qorvelsys.internal
  pin: 2191
  pool_size: 32